مجلة الأوائل - العالم بين يديك ..  
 
أƒâ€¦أƒإ،أƒآ،أƒâ€،أƒآ¤أƒâ€،أƒإ 

 

الرئيسية » لفيجوال بيسك - Visual Basic

     
 
اضيف بواسطة اسلام رفعت

شرح واجهة الفيجوال بيسك

هذه الواجهه سوف تظهر عند بدء تشغيل الفيجوال بيسك وفي الأسفل شرح لها.
يمكنك إزالتها من بدء التشغيل عن طريق تفعيل علامة الإختيار Dont't Show this dialog in the future


علامات التبيويب في أعلى الواجهة:
New : وتعني إختيار مشروع جديد
Existing : فتح ملفات مخزنة لديك .
Recent : قائمة بآخر الملفات التي قمت بفتحها حسب التاريخ

New يضم مايلي
Standard EXE : وهو يقوم بإنشاء برنامج تنفيذي بعد طلبك لذلك من ( Make EXE) في قائمة ( File ) .
Activex EXE : وهو أيضاً يقوم بإنشاء ملفاً له الامتداد ( DLL ) وهو ملف ذو برامج...

القرائات : 193 | التعليقات : 0
 
     
 

 

     
 
اضيف بواسطة اسلام رفعت

شكل الفورم والتعامل معه
النموذج ( الفورم ) و هو عبارة عن نافذة أو هو عبارة عن نموذج فارغ و هو الذي نكوّن و نضع عليه الرسوم و الصور و الأزرار و عناصر الإدخال و الإخراج و غير ذلك و الذي سيكون واجهة برنامجك الذي ستصنعه .
وهو حقيقة يشبه لوحة رسم لأنك تستطيع الرسم عليه بسهولة كما يمكنك تغيير حجمه و لونه و أطرافه , كما تستطيع تغيير عنوانه و سنرى كل ذلك بإذن الله تعالى.
im_vb/form.gif
شكل الفورم
ملاحظة : الفورم السابق هو نتيجة إختيارنا في البداية لـ standar.exe .
هذا يعني أن هذا الفورم هو الفورم الإفتراضي .
* كيف نغير عنوان الفورم من كلمة form1 إلى العنوان الذي نريده ؟
حسنا هذا ليس صعبا على الاطلاق ... انقر فوق الفورم نقرة واحدة ( لتحدده أو تختاره ) , ثم اذهب لمربع الخصائص أو نافذة الخصائص properties window ( موقعه على...

القرائات : 188 | التعليقات : 0
 
     

     
 
اضيف بواسطة اسلام رفعت

شرح صندوق كتابة الشيفرة والأحداث
صندوق الشيفرة هو الذي يتم كتابة الكود الخاص بأي عمل بداخله وهو الذي يحوي التصريحات والأحداث
تستطيع فتحة عن طريق الضغط نقرتين فوق الأداة. أو عن طريق im_vb/codeviw.JPG الموجود على شجرة المشروع.
هذا هو شكله
im_vb/code.JPG
لكتابة الكود الخاص بأي أمر أنقر فوق الأداة التي تحوي حدث نقرتين فيفتح لك صندوق الشيفرة . ويجهز سطراً للكتابة .
لتغيير الحدث مثلاً عند ضغط مفتاح أو عند التحريك أنقر فوق القائمة على اليمن لعرض كافة الأحداث للأداة المحددة.
فمثلاً السطرين في الصورة السابقة هما نتيجة للنقر المزدوج فوق الفورم وهو حدث التحميل Load نكتب الكود...

القرائات : 238 | التعليقات : 0
 
     

     
 
اضيف بواسطة اسلام رفعت

شرح النوافذ الرئيسيه للفيجوال بيسك

مايكروسوفت فيجوال بيسك هو من أسهل لغات البرمجة الموجودة حالياً. ورغم بساطة هذه اللغة إلا أنها من القوة بما يكفي لبرمجة برامج قادرة على إدارة رجل آلي أو حتى اختراق أكبر موقع في الإنترنت. تجمع هذه اللغة بين القوة والبساطة في بيئة رسومية سهلة التعامل قلما تجد مثلها في اللغات الأخرى. بالنتيجة، هذه اللغة أداة قوية وفعالة في كتابة البرامج تحت بيئة التشغيل ميكروسوفت ويندوز

تصنف لغة الفجوال بيسك بأنها لغة مسيرة بالأحداث Event Response هذا يعني أن لغة الفيجوال بيسك تتعامل مع الأحداث الناتجة من المستخدم؛ مثل: الضغط على إحدى أزرار لوحة المفاتيح أو الضغط على أحد الأزرار من شاشة البرنامج بواسطة الفأرة وغيرها. سوف نتحدث أكثر عن الأحداث والاستجابة لها فيما بعد. الجدير بالذكر أن هذا القالب هو نفس القالب الذي يتحكم بالويندوز. حيث أن الويندوز نفسه من هذا النوع. لذلك يعتبر فيجوال بيسك الأفضل لكتابة البرامج لهذه البيئة
آخر إصدار من الفيجوال بيسك هو...

القرائات : 186 | التعليقات : 3
 
     

     
 
اضيف بواسطة اسلام رفعت

التعرف على ادوات البرنامج ومراحل كتابة البرنامج

اولا : بيئة ويندوز متعددة المهام

يمكن لـ ويندوز أن تشغل أكثر من تطبيق في وقت واحد وهو مايعرف بتعدد المهام Multitasking
تقوم ويندوز بتوزيع إمكانيات الجهاز بين التطبيقات المختلفة التي تعمل في نفس الوقت مما يؤدي إلى أن تعمل هذه التطبيقات جنبا إلى جنب ولأنه من الممكن أن يعمل أكثر من تطبيق على نفس الجهاز في وقت واحد فإن هذه التطبيقات تتقاسم فيما بينها الإمكانات المتاحة بالجهاز مثل شاشة الجهاز والذاكرة وأهم من ذلك تتقاسم وقت المعالج المركزي
CPU
لذلك عندما تصمم برنامجك يجب أن تضع في ذهنك احتمال وجود برامج أخرى تعمل في نفس الوقت وألا تحتكر أيا من موارد النظام
System Resources
مثل الذاكرة أو الشاشة . هذه نقطة مهمة جدا في فهم فلسفة البرمجة لـ ويندوز بشكل عام ولـفيجول بيسيك بشكل خاص فإذا كنت قد كتبت برامج بأي لغة لنظام دوس...

القرائات : 218 | التعليقات : 2
 
     

     
 
اضيف بواسطة اسلام رفعت

معنى الخصائص ، ضبط الخصائص ، الخصائص المشتركه
معنى الخصائص :
لكل أداة من أدوات فيجول بيسيك بما في ذلك نافذة البرنامج ويوجد عدة خصائص لنافذة البرنامج مثل خاصية الخط
FontName وهي تحدد اسم الخط وخاصيته BackColor وهي تحدد لون الخلفية للنافذة BackColor
أو الأداة
ويوجد خصائص كثيرة في كل أداة من الأدوات

وعندما تضع أداة على نافذة البرنامج فإن فيجول بيسيك يضع قيماً افتراضية لخصائصها . فإذا لم تعجبك هذه القيم الافتراضية فإنه يمكنك أن تغيرها وتضع لها قيمـاً جديدة

فمثلاً : يختار فيجول بيسيك خط ms sans serif للأدوات التي لها عنوان مثل أزرار الأوامر فإذا لم يعجبك
هذا الخط فإنه يمكنك أن تغيره إلى أي خط موجود في ويندوز والهدف من وضع قيم افتراضية لخصائص الأدوات هو التسهيل عليك . فلو ترك فيجول بيسيك كل الخصائص بدون قيمة ستضطر إلى وضع قيمة لكل خاصية...

القرائات : 198 | التعليقات : 0
 
     

     
 
اضيف بواسطة اسلام رفعت

شرح نافذة الخصائص

في هذا الجدول خصائص عناصر التحكم القياسية
كل خاصيه ستجد الشرح تحتها

name
تحديد اسم للاداة
backcolor
لون الخلفية
borderstyle
نوع وسمك اطار النافذة
caption
عنوان الاداة
text
عنوان الاداة
controlbox
مايظهر في اعلى كل نافذة في اقصى اليمن للتحكم بالنافذة
enabled
لتمكين الاداة
font
الخط
forecolor
اللون الامامي
height
الارتفاع
icon
الرمز
left
موقع الاداة من اليسار
mdichild
تستخدم في البرامج متعددة النوافذ
mousepointer
مؤشر الفارة
picture
الصورة
righttoleft
مفيدة جدا في البرامج العربية لتحويل القوائم من اليسار الى اليمين
top
موقع الركن العلوي من الاداة
visible
اخفاء الاداة
width
العرض
windowstate
حالة النافذة من حيث الحجم
backstyle
جعل الاداة شفافة
borderstyle
حذف الاطار المحيط...
القرائات : 170 | التعليقات : 0
 
     

     
 
اضيف بواسطة اسلام رفعت

شرح صندوق الأدوات

Picture Box
im_vb/picbox.JPG
صندوق عرض الصور
Text Box
im_vb/text.JPG
أداة النصوص والكتابة
Label
im_vb/label.JPG
أداة عرض النصوص
Frame
im_vb/form.JPG
إطارات داخل البرنامج
Check Box
im_vb/chec.JPG
زر إختيار
Combo Box
im_vb/combo.JPG
قائمة منسدلة
Command Button
im_vb/command.JPG
زر أمر
Data Control
im_vb/data.JPG
القرائات : 198 | التعليقات : 1
 
     

     
 
اضيف بواسطة اسلام رفعت

عمل برنامج من المشروع

بعد أن عملت برنامجاً على الفيجوال بيسك فإنك سوف تحفظه وطريقة الحفظ هي :
1- عند إغلاق الفيجوال بيسك فسوف يتم سؤالك إذا كنت تريد الحفظ . تختار Yes فيظهر لك صندوق حوار ويكون قد أعطى لمشروعك إسم Project1
لنفرض أنك لم تغير الإسم . أنقر فوق الزر Save فيتم حفظ المشروع ...
2- ويمكنك الحفظ من قائمة File ثم تختار Save وتحفظ المشروع
بعد ان حفظنا المشروع ( البرنامج ) باسم project1 اذهب قائمة File ثم اختر منها make project1.exe
طبعا عند حفظ البرنامج البرنامج فجوال بيسيك تلقائيا يضيف العبارة make project1.exe
ليسهل عليك العمل و هذا اكيد يختلف فعندك مثلا لا يظهر make project1.exe لكن يظهر اسم البرنامج الذي حفظته
الان اذهب للمسار الذي كنت حفظت فيه البرنامج تراه قد عمل ايقونة لبرنامجك اوتوماتيكيا و عند النقر على الايقونة يفتح برنامجك الرائع...

القرائات : 151 | التعليقات : 2
 
     

     
 
اضيف بواسطة اسلام رفعت

عمل برنامج Setup

طريقة صنع Setup هامة بعد الإنتهاء من تصميم برنامج فإذا أردت نقل البرنامج لوحده دون ان تضعه في Setup فلن يعمل على جهاز أخر
لأن له ملفات نظام تساعده على عمله فعليك تشغيل معالج الحزم وصنع برنامج Setup لأنه يحفظ كافة الملفات التي يحتاجها برنامجك للعمل
هذا البرنامج package & deployment wizard تجده مع أدوات فيجوال بيسك 6
وهذه خطوات العمل محددة بمستطيل أحمر :
أولاً عليك النقر فوق زر Browser لتحديد مشروعك طبعاً بعد الإنتهاء من تصميمه. ثم أنقر فوق الزر Package لبدء العمل
طبعاً تأكد من أنك عملته برنامج تنفيذي exe لأن برنامج الحزم إذا لم يعثر على برنامج تنفيذي سيخبرك وينشء برنامج تنفيذي

القرائات : 294 | التعليقات : 1
 
     
 

 

[1] - [2] - [3] - [4] - 5 - [6] - [7] - [8] - [9] - [10] - [11] - [12]



اكتر المقالات قراءة
» الملاحظات 1
» خطوات إنشاء الماكرو في تذييل النموذج (2)0--
» الكائن Request- الجزء الثاني 2
» درس ::تصميم فرش لحرق وتمزيق أطراف الورقه:
» لإضافة خلفية صوتية في بريد الهوتميل يمكنك ذلك عن طريق استخدام كود بسيط.1
» دورة الأكسس: الدرس السادس : منوعات في أكسيس .0---
» خطوات إنشاء الماكرو في تذييل النموذج (1)0-
» فكرة البرنامج**
» الدرس العاشر : الشكل الثالث 3) التراكيب المتداخله وتركيبة do/while
» تصميم نموذج إدخال‎ ‎البيانات0---
» Shell Script Programming
» مصطلحات شائعه بعالم الانترنت
» الدرس السادس: الحلقات التكرارية Loops
» نظام التشغيل (دوس Dos)
» كيفية معرفة مواصفات جهازك من خلال موجة الدوس ( MS-DOS )
» اقسام الأوامر لدوس
» تضمين الملفات
» هل تريد الاحتفاظ بمعلوماتك سرية بعيداً عن أعين المتطفلين إذا ما عليك إلا
» استعلامات SQL في Access - تعديل الجداول وإضافة الحقول0-
» عمل ملف الـconfiguration وهو ما أسميناه بالاسم config.php
» Select Case
» النسبة المئوية لا تظهر بالخط العربي & الشدة وألف المد في لفظ الجلالة0---
» سلسلة أوامر الدوس 7
» مفهوم قواعد البيانات 1
» إنشاء قوائم خاصة باستخدام الماكرو(1)0--
» كتابة الأرقام الكسرية ورموز المعادلات0--
» درس كامل عن الدمج السهل من لوحة المفاتيح ف0-ي برنامج الـ Word
» كيفية اضافة علاقات بين جداول قواعد بيانات ميكروسوفت اكسس برمجيا باستخدام فيجول بيسك
» وضع صورة كخلفية للنص0--
» استخدام لوحة المفاتيح في الـ Word0----
جميع الحقوق محفوظه © 2007 لمكتبة الدروس